[Bug 1324062] [NEW] No lua 5.2 support

We'd like to support lua 5.2 in main only, and move away from 5.1. But
some upstreams don't yet have support for lua 5.2 yet.
Related: apache bug 1323930 (lua support regression due to failed move
to 5.2) and bug 1262710 (in particular comment 25) for discussion of the
same issue with nginx, and of having both lua 5.1 and 5.2 in main.
